Hi already used smartGit Hg a couple of months. I have already account in bitbucket which I used already couple months already also. When I created another account in bitbucket
SmartGit probably remember a wrong account credentials to authenticate you on BitBucket.
Goto Edit menu -> Preferences -> Authentication
and remove credentials for the repository that fails.
Then next time you push SmartGit will ask you for both login and password.